OpenModelica是一款免费开源的仿真建模系统,这款工具主要用于工业界和学术界研究,软件具备了图形化的建模工具,支持通过拖放模型库的部件来建模。例如,有一个交互式OpenModelica Shell(OMShell)和一个高级交互式编译器(OMC),其目标是将Modelica代码编译为C以进行模拟。OMC有一个可用于查询Modelica代码的API,可以从控制台接口或作为CORBA对象使用。
软件优势:
1、一种新的(独立的)基于FMI和TLM的仿真工具OMSimulator
2、FMU组合模型的图形配置编辑
3、对状态机和转换的基本图形编辑支持(还不支持在图层上显示状态内部结构)
4、更快的查找处理,使一些库浏览和编译更快
5、多体动画的其他高级可视化功能
6、增加图书馆覆盖率,包括显著增加验证覆盖率
7、通过添加ZeroMQ通信协议提高了工具互操作性
8、进一步增强的复杂性,包括线性化,现在也可以使用python 3
9、支持OpenModelica的RedHat/Fedora二进制版本
安装说明:
1.下载解压完成后,运行对应操作系统安装包,有32位和64位;
2.选择组件,这里默认跳过;
3.点击“Browse...”选择安装路径;
4.是否更改所在路径文件夹名称;
5.等待进度条到达百分之百,因为高达几个GB的缓存,所以比较慢;
6.安装成功;
7.点击左下角开始菜单可以看到有关OpenModelica的组件,卸载的话点击“Uninstall OpenModelica”就OK啦。